33 Orobi St., El Azbakeya, Downtown, Cairo
Categories: Valves & Taps 1 + Keywords: Valves & Taps Stud Bolts 1 +
Phone Number Website
El Manashy Rd., Nekla, Manshyet el qanatir, Giza Beside Villa El Masry
Categories: Valves & Taps 1 + Keywords: Pipes and Tubes and Pipelines Seamless Pipe 1 +
Phone Number Website